Handover Note — Marketing Directorship, Verelia Goods

Welcome aboard. Please note the marketing budget was reduced by 18% last quarter following the Brenmark campaign review. I have protected spend for the Oakline launch, but sponsorships and the Castry trade events were cut entirely. Dalia Fenn in finance holds the revised allocations and can walk you through the phasing. Treat the figures below as provisional. The confidential note that follows explains the strategic reasoning behind the cut.

internal memo for yahag-tahog: The pricing group signed off on a budget of $152.8 million for Project Soriel.

Ticket: Unlock migration vault for Ironvine ORM refactor

New team members: the legacy Ironvine ORM layer is being replaced module by module, and the schema snapshots needed for safe refactoring sit in a locked vault nobody has opened since the last owner left. We recovered the credentials from escrow this week. The passphrase follows below.

unlock words, kajog-yawip: istwyn-casath-aldok

Handover — Skerry breaker

Taking over from me: Skerry wraps calls to the upstream Vantish pricing API with a circuit breaker. It trips on consecutive failures, half-opens after a cooldown, and falls back to cached quotes. Nothing exotic, but don't loosen the thresholds without load-testing first. The current settings in production are as follows.

deployment values, kajep-kageg:
[praix]
host = praix.paliqcorp.corp
user = praix_svc
database = praix_prod

- [ ] Step 7: Archive cold storage buckets (Glacierline tier). Confirm both ceremony witnesses are present, verify bucket manifests match the Oxbow ledger, then seal the archive key shares. Plugin authors may observe but not handle shares. Once sealed, the archive index itself is encrypted and can only be reopened with the passphrase below.

vault phrase of badup-hahig = tamael-aldael-kelmir-istael-fenok-istwyn-tamius-jorath-oliion